首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从现场麦克风中检测带有pyaudio的水龙头

,可以通过以下步骤进行:

  1. 首先,需要了解pyaudio是什么。Pyaudio是一个用于音频处理的Python库,它提供了一系列函数和工具,可以用于录制、播放和处理音频数据。
  2. 接下来,需要了解水龙头是什么。水龙头是一种用于控制水流的装置,通常用于供水系统中。它可以打开或关闭水流,并调节水流的强度。
  3. 在这个场景中,我们需要使用麦克风来检测带有pyaudio的水龙头。这意味着我们需要使用pyaudio库来录制从麦克风接收到的音频数据,并对其进行分析和处理,以检测水龙头的存在。
  4. 首先,我们可以使用pyaudio库中的函数来初始化麦克风,并设置相应的参数,如采样率、声道数等。
  5. 然后,我们可以使用pyaudio库中的函数来开始录制音频数据。通过将麦克风与计算机连接,并设置适当的输入设备,我们可以开始录制从麦克风接收到的音频数据。
  6. 接下来,我们可以对录制到的音频数据进行分析和处理,以检测水龙头的存在。这可以通过应用信号处理算法来实现,如频谱分析、滤波器设计等。
  7. 最后,根据分析结果,我们可以判断是否存在带有pyaudio的水龙头。如果检测到水龙头的存在,可以采取相应的措施,如发出警报或记录相关信息。

在腾讯云的产品中,可以使用云音视频服务(https://cloud.tencent.com/product/tcavs)来处理音频数据。该服务提供了一系列功能,如音频录制、音频转码、音频处理等,可以满足音频处理的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

python语音识别终极指南

麦克使用 若要使用 SpeechRecognizer 访问麦克风则必须安装 PyAudio 软件包,请关闭当前解释器窗口,进行以下操作: 安装 PyAudio 安装 PyAudio 过程会因操作系统而异...可以使用 with 块中 Recognizer 类 listen()方法捕获麦克输入。该方法将音频源作为第一个参数,并自动记录来自源输入,直到检测到静音时自动停止。...执行 with 块后请尝试在麦克风中说出 “hello” 。请等待解释器再次显示提示,一旦出现 “>>>” 提示返回就可以识别语音。...运行上面的代码后稍等片刻,尝试在麦克风中说 “hello” 。同样,必须等待解释器提示返回后再尝试识别语音。...根据我经验,一秒钟默认持续时间对于大多数应用程序已经足够。 处理难以识别的语音 尝试将前面的代码示例输入到解释器中,并在麦克风中输入一些无法理解噪音。

4.2K80

Python语音识别终极指南

麦克使用 若要使用 SpeechRecognizer 访问麦克风则必须安装 PyAudio 软件包,请关闭当前解释器窗口,进行以下操作: 安装 PyAudio 安装 PyAudio 过程会因操作系统而异...可以使用 with 块中 Recognizer 类 listen()方法捕获麦克输入。该方法将音频源作为第一个参数,并自动记录来自源输入,直到检测到静音时自动停止。...执行 with 块后请尝试在麦克风中说出 “hello” 。请等待解释器再次显示提示,一旦出现 “>>>” 提示返回就可以识别语音。...运行上面的代码后稍等片刻,尝试在麦克风中说 “hello” 。同样,必须等待解释器提示返回后再尝试识别语音。...根据我经验,一秒钟默认持续时间对于大多数应用程序已经足够。 处理难以识别的语音 尝试将前面的代码示例输入到解释器中,并在麦克风中输入一些无法理解噪音。

3.8K40

python语音识别终极指南

麦克使用 若要使用 SpeechRecognizer 访问麦克风则必须安装 PyAudio 软件包,请关闭当前解释器窗口,进行以下操作: 安装 PyAudio 安装 PyAudio 过程会因操作系统而异...可以使用 with 块中 Recognizer 类 listen()方法捕获麦克输入。该方法将音频源作为第一个参数,并自动记录来自源输入,直到检测到静音时自动停止。...执行 with 块后请尝试在麦克风中说出 “hello” 。请等待解释器再次显示提示,一旦出现 “>>>” 提示返回就可以识别语音。...运行上面的代码后稍等片刻,尝试在麦克风中说 “hello” 。同样,必须等待解释器提示返回后再尝试识别语音。...根据我经验,一秒钟默认持续时间对于大多数应用程序已经足够。 处理难以识别的语音 尝试将前面的代码示例输入到解释器中,并在麦克风中输入一些无法理解噪音。

3.5K70

Python语音识别终极指北,没错,就是指北!

麦克使用 若要使用 SpeechRecognizer 访问麦克风则必须安装 PyAudio 软件包,请关闭当前解释器窗口,进行以下操作: 安装 PyAudio 安装 PyAudio 过程会因操作系统而异...可以使用 with 块中 Recognizer 类 listen()方法捕获麦克输入。该方法将音频源作为第一个参数,并自动记录来自源输入,直到检测到静音时自动停止。...执行 with 块后请尝试在麦克风中说出 “hello” 。请等待解释器再次显示提示,一旦出现 “>>>” 提示返回就可以识别语音。...运行上面的代码后稍等片刻,尝试在麦克风中说 “hello” 。同样,必须等待解释器提示返回后再尝试识别语音。...根据我经验,一秒钟默认持续时间对于大多数应用程序已经足够。 处理难以识别的语音 尝试将前面的代码示例输入到解释器中,并在麦克风中输入一些无法理解噪音。

2.9K20

这一篇就够了 python语音识别指南终极版

麦克使用 若要使用 SpeechRecognizer 访问麦克风则必须安装 PyAudio 软件包,请关闭当前解释器窗口,进行以下操作: 安装 PyAudio 安装 PyAudio 过程会因操作系统而异...可以使用 with 块中 Recognizer 类 listen()方法捕获麦克输入。该方法将音频源作为第一个参数,并自动记录来自源输入,直到检测到静音时自动停止。...执行 with 块后请尝试在麦克风中说出 “hello” 。请等待解释器再次显示提示,一旦出现 “>>>” 提示返回就可以识别语音。...运行上面的代码后稍等片刻,尝试在麦克风中说 “hello” 。同样,必须等待解释器提示返回后再尝试识别语音。...根据我经验,一秒钟默认持续时间对于大多数应用程序已经足够。 处理难以识别的语音 尝试将前面的代码示例输入到解释器中,并在麦克风中输入一些无法理解噪音。

6K10

Python语音识别终极指北,没错,就是指北!

麦克使用 若要使用 SpeechRecognizer 访问麦克风则必须安装 PyAudio 软件包,请关闭当前解释器窗口,进行以下操作: 安装 PyAudio 安装 PyAudio 过程会因操作系统而异...可以使用 with 块中 Recognizer 类 listen()方法捕获麦克输入。该方法将音频源作为第一个参数,并自动记录来自源输入,直到检测到静音时自动停止。...执行 with 块后请尝试在麦克风中说出 “hello” 。请等待解释器再次显示提示,一旦出现 “>>>” 提示返回就可以识别语音。...运行上面的代码后稍等片刻,尝试在麦克风中说 “hello” 。同样,必须等待解释器提示返回后再尝试识别语音。...根据我经验,一秒钟默认持续时间对于大多数应用程序已经足够。 处理难以识别的语音 尝试将前面的代码示例输入到解释器中,并在麦克风中输入一些无法理解噪音。

3.6K40

Python语音识别终极指北,没错,就是指北!

麦克使用 若要使用 SpeechRecognizer 访问麦克风则必须安装 PyAudio 软件包,请关闭当前解释器窗口,进行以下操作: 安装 PyAudio 安装 PyAudio 过程会因操作系统而异...可以使用 with 块中 Recognizer 类 listen()方法捕获麦克输入。该方法将音频源作为第一个参数,并自动记录来自源输入,直到检测到静音时自动停止。...执行 with 块后请尝试在麦克风中说出 “hello” 。请等待解释器再次显示提示,一旦出现 “>>>” 提示返回就可以识别语音。...运行上面的代码后稍等片刻,尝试在麦克风中说 “hello” 。同样,必须等待解释器提示返回后再尝试识别语音。...根据我经验,一秒钟默认持续时间对于大多数应用程序已经足够。 处理难以识别的语音 尝试将前面的代码示例输入到解释器中,并在麦克风中输入一些无法理解噪音。

5.1K30

建立智能解决方案:将TensorFlow用于声音分类

这样应用程序和服务能够以一种很不错质量识别语音然后转换成文本,但没有一个能够对麦克风所捕捉到不同声音做出判断。 ?...正如我们所看到,我们在训练阶段取得了不错成绩,但这并不意味着我们会在完整评估中得到好结果。 不平衡训练 让我们试试不平衡训练数据集。...使用带有音频采集设备训练模型 现在我们有了一些经过训练模型,是时候添加一些代码来与它们交互了。 我们需要从一个麦克风中获取音频数据。因此,我们将使用PyAudio。...我们工作结果:https://github.com/devicehive/devicehive-audio-analysis 安装 PyAudio使用libportaudio2和portaudio19...这些值是神经网络做出预测。较高值意味着属于该类输入文件几率更高。 2.麦克风获取和处理数据 python capture.py启动了麦克风中获取数据过程。

1.9K71

教程 | 如何使用TensorFlow实现音频分类任务

这些应用和服务能够以相当好性能将人类语音识别成文本,但是其中却没有一个能够分得清麦克风捕捉到是哪一种声音:人声、动物声音或者音乐演奏声。...还有 3 个用来计算损失函数,以及很多其他有用变量,你可以改变它们来提升结果。 现在我们已经有了一些训练好模型,是时候添加一些代码与它们交互了。我们需要从麦克风采集音频。...这里我们使用 PyAudio,它提供了可以在很多平台上运行简单接口。 音频准备 正如我们之前所提及,我们要使用 TensorFlow VGGish 模型作为特征提取器。...安装 PyAudio 使用 libportaudio2 和 portaudio19-dev,所以在安装 PyAudio 之前需要先安装这两个工具。...麦克风中捕捉并处理数据 运行 python capture.py 开始麦克风中无限制地采集数据。默认配置下,它会每 5-7s 将数据输入到神经网络。可以在其中看到之前例子结果。

3.3K71

Linux下利用python实现语音识别详细教程

麦克使用 中文语音识别 小范围中文识别 语音合成 语音识别工作原理简介 语音识别源于 20 世纪 50 年代早期在贝尔实验室所做研究。...通过麦克风,语音便物理声音被转换为电信号,然后通过模数转换器转换为数据。一旦被数字化,就可适用若干种模型,将音频转录为文本。 大多数现代语音识别系统都依赖于隐马尔可夫模型(HMM)。...许多现代语音识别系统会在 HMM 识别之前使用神经网络,通过特征变换和降维技术来简化语音信号。也可以使用语音活动检测器(VAD)将音频信号减少到可能仅包含语音部分。...同时注意,安装 PyAudio 包来获取麦克风输入 识别器类 SpeechRecognition 核心就是识别器类。...如果使用是基于 DebianLinux(如 Ubuntu ),则可使用 apt 安装 PyAudio:sudo apt-get install python-pyaudio python3-pyaudio

2.4K50

不行

本程序第 4.7 秒开始记录,从而使得词组 “it takes heat to bring out the odor” ,中 “it t” 没有被记录下来,此时 API 只得到 “akes heat...▌麦克使用 若要使用 SpeechRecognizer 访问麦克风则必须安装 PyAudio 软件包,请关闭当前解释器窗口,进行以下操作: 安装 PyAudio 安装 PyAudio 过程会因操作系统而异...安装测试 安装了 PyAudio 后可从控制台进行安装测试。...请对着麦克风讲话并观察 SpeechRecognition 如何转录你讲话。 Microphone 类 请打开另一个解释器会话,并创建识一个别器类例子。...由于麦克风输入声音可预测性不如音频文件,因此任何时间听麦克风输入时都可以使用此过程进行处理。

2.2K20

『开发技巧』Python音频操作工具PyAudio上手教程

PyAudio是Python开源工具包,由名思义,是提供对语音操作工具包。提供录音播放处理等功能,可以视作语音领域OpenCv。...PyAudio灵感来自: pyPortAudio / fastaudio:PortAudio v18 APIPython绑定。...tkSnack:Tcl / Tk和Python跨平台声音工具包。 2.安装 目前版本是PyAudio v0.2.11。在大多数平台上使用pip安装PyAudio。...有关为各种平台构建PyAudio一些说明,请参阅编译提示。要使用Microsoft Visual Studio构建PyAudio,请查看Sebastian Audet说明。...3.示例 1).采集音频 下面以一段代码演示如何计算机麦克风采集一段音频,采集音频时长 4s,保存文件 output.wav 使用了tqdm模块,可以方便显示出来读取过程,如下: * recording

4.7K20

基于麦克风阵列现有声源定位技术有_阵列原理

根据本发明一方面,提供一种使用麦克风阵列对声源定位方法,所述麦克风 阵列为构成正三角形三个麦克风,所述方法包括建立坐标系,所述坐标系原点与所 述正三角形重心重合,三个麦克风中第一麦克风位于坐标系纵轴上...在本发明中,采用 了准Ll相关技术提高时间延迟估计速度和抗野值干扰能力,进一步采用时间延迟特性 进行方位分割以提高计算速度和去除局部极值点,同时可采用0. 618法加快逼近速度, 而可以用普通微型计算机在数十毫秒级解决声源定位问题...参照图1和图2,在步骤201,建立坐标系,坐标系原点0(0,0)与第一麦克风a、 第二麦克风b、第三麦克风c构成正三角形重心重合,三个麦克风中一个麦克风(例 如第一麦克风a)位于坐标系纵轴上。...,所述坐标系原点与所述正三角形重心重合,三个麦克风中第一麦 克风位于坐标系纵轴上;将正三角形重心与正三角形三个顶点连接并延长,从而将以所述正三角形重心 为圆心全圆周分为6个相等区间;计算声源分别到达三个麦克风中第一麦克风...6.一种使用麦克风阵列对声源定位方法,所述麦克风阵列为构成正三角形三个麦 克风,所述方法包括建立坐标系,所述坐标系原点与所述正三角形重心重合,三个麦克风中第一麦 克风位于坐标系纵轴上;计算声源分别到达三个麦克风中第一麦克

70220

python语音智能对话聊天机器人--linux&&树莓派双平台兼容

使用录音设备我用是 Raspberry Pi B+ 3代 USB麦克风 话筒 免驱动 pcduino 树莓派专用 录音命令使用是arecord arecord,aplay是命令行ALSA声卡驱动录音和播放工具...,测试代码如下.如有以为情参看之前博文 代码比较长请博客或者github获取 3:图灵机器人 官方网址:图灵机器人-中文语境下智能度最高机器人大脑 图灵机器人部分测试代码 难度不大非常轻松.你得去注册一下...这部分代码不可运行,在整体源代码中可以.不过这部分稍微需要抽取出来,作为理解 建立pa是pyudio对象,可以获取当前音高,然后检测当音高超过200就启动,录音.同时有一个5秒额外限制....NUM_SAMPLES = 2000 # pyAudio内部缓存大小 SAMPLING_RATE = 8000 # 取样频率 LEVEL = 1500 # 声音保存阈值...还有录音识别效率问题,问题主要集中在百度有他要求,所以得设定16bit.然后再听一遍录制声音,看看音量会不会太大,,有没有很粗糙声音.最好能分开测试 8:源代码-树莓派环境下 pyaudio错误得我不要不要

2.1K20

5G Edge-XR 中音频处理

图1 首先是内容生成,视频或者音频资源摄像机和麦克风实时提取,并被编码和上传到GPU处理系统。...图 5 图5 展示了用于检测高瞬态音频事件卷积神经网络模型,例如拳击比赛中出拳。 在内容分析和在提取过程中,会自动创建可以用于混合决策内容标志或触发预录内容来增强广播音频。...三角测量方法因捕获装置不同而不同,但通常是利用不同麦克风对信号之间到达时间差 (TDOA) 来实现。知道这些麦克位置,可以将源定位在两个麦克风之间双曲线路径上。...如果在其他麦克风中接收到相同信号源,就会出现额外双曲线,而产生曲线之间重叠使信号源准确定位/三角定位成为可能。...由于实时事件高背景噪声,使用传统算法(如互相关联)来确定TDOAs会出现一些问题,因此我们使用我们Al来提取每个麦克风中检测时间戳来确定TDOAs,以使得音源定位更加准确。

67220

声音分类迁移学习

这是就是频谱图有用地方。在听觉研究中,频谱图是在垂直轴表示频率,在水平轴表示时间音频图示,而第三维颜色表示每个时间点x频率位置处声音强度。 例如,这里是小提琴演奏频谱图: ?...这个想法是,网络开始层正在解决诸如边缘检测和基本形状检测问题,这将推广到其他类别。...在大约16k次迭代之后,验证集精度达大约达到86%。对于一个相当初步分类方法来说还是不错。 ? ? 分类来自麦克声音 现在我们有一个分类声音模型,可以将其应用于分类麦克风声音。...Tensorflow再训练示例有用于标记图像脚本。 我修改了这个脚本来标记麦克声音。首先,脚本使用pyaudio麦克风播放音频,并使用webrtcvad包来检测麦克风是否存在声音。...脚本改编自该要旨,用于麦克风声音记录,并且这要旨使用librosa生成频谱图,以及将label_image.py在tensorflow标注脚本。

2.3K41

​B站UP主硬核自制智能音箱:有ChatGPT加持,才是真・智能

视频地址:https://www.bilibili.com/video/BV11M411F7Ww/ 自制过程 作者设计架构草图如下,语音输入到音箱回复,大致分为四个步骤:唤醒、语音识别、ChatGPT...硬件方面,自然是极客不二之选:树莓派。 作者翻出尘封了几年树莓派 3 Model B,发现它并未自带麦克风。只能在某宝光速下单,一边等快递,一边先用电脑调试。 接下来就是系统搭建工作了。...经过在线录音和训练后,得到了下载即用模型。作者编写了一个脚本来运行唤醒词检测检测之后会回应一声「咦」。...唤醒之后,作者用基于 Python 语音处理库「PyAudio」来录制声音,假如此时你不想钻研项目文档,可以直接让 ChatGPT 给出示例代码,再做些微调即可。...第三步就是将 Azure 识别结果发送给 ChatGPT,收到回复后再进行语音合成(TTS),通过音箱播放出来。 经过一番调试之后,网购麦克风也到货了,将整套系统移植到树莓派,大功告成。

41720
领券